  • Wedding Boundaries

    Setting boundaries with an alcoholic parent during a wedding is crucial to ensure a smooth celebration. suggests having a candid conversation with the parent, clearly outlining expectations for sobriety on the wedding day 1. He emphasizes the importance of being direct to prevent misunderstandings, as indirect communication might lead to the parent underestimating the seriousness of the request 2. adds that enlisting support from family members and wedding coordinators can help manage any potential disruptions 3.

    Being prepared to enforce these boundaries, even if it means asking the parent to leave, is essential to protect the integrity of the event.

       

    Family Support

    Supporting an addicted family member while maintaining one's own mental health is a delicate balance. advises seeking external support, such as Al-Anon meetings, to gain insights from others who have faced similar challenges 4. He highlights the importance of not only helping the addicted family member but also ensuring personal well-being 4. stresses the value of building a support network outside the immediate family, which can provide essential encouragement and accountability 5.
